WOMEN OF BRITAIN
MRS WINANT'S HIGH TRIBUTE. (British Official Wireless.) RUGBY. June 19. Mrs John Winant. wife of the American Ambassador to London, addressing the Forum Club at lunch, said she wished to express her sense oi “the magnificent response of English women” to the conditions existing under the blitz. She paid a high tribute to the work which women were doing in all spheres of activity, specially thenceaseless day-to-day hard work in occupations which had now advanced far beyond any interest of novelty, and had become an absolutely essential part of the nation's war effort.
